BARRACUDA NETWORKS INC Insider Trading Monthly Overview

FREE EMAIL WATCHDOG

Get free email notifications about insider trading in BARRACUDA NETWORKS INC.

  • Your email is safe with us.
  • The service is free and you can unsubscribe at any time.

General | Insiders | Insider Transactions | Monthly Overview | Weekly Overview


Monthly overview of insider trading in BARRACUDA NETWORKS INC.

BARRACUDA NETWORKS INC Insider Trading Monthly Overview

YearMonth Insider Buy CountInsider Sell Count Buy CountSell Count Shares BoughtShares Sold Buy / Sell Price of Shares Bought ($)Price of Shares Sold ($)Balance ($)
201820100 x23 x03,483,387 STRONG SELL000Transaction Details
20181010 x1 x0549 STRONG SELL015,076+15,076Transaction Details
201712424 x2 x1,8382,892 SELL079,559+79,559Transaction Details
201711232 x5 x2,6404,603 STRONG SELL26,972104,543+77,571Transaction Details
201710141 x25 x1,3901,000,388 STRONG SELL17,22225,193,360+25,176,137Transaction Details
20179647 x90 x55,8561,821,410 STRONG SELL730,27544,186,766+43,456,492Transaction Details
20178646 x16 x83,342289,741 STRONG SELL9,7506,903,805+6,894,055Transaction Details
20177151 x9 x1,250486,640 STRONG SELL9,75011,731,028+11,721,278Transaction Details
2017610512 x7 x343,48527,287 STRONG BUY57,200619,836+562,636Transaction Details
20175555 x7 x91,41523,954 STRONG BUY57,190492,678+435,489Transaction Details
20174233 x3 x5,7187,819 SELL53,959177,406+123,447Transaction Details
20173444 x11 x4,85187,278 STRONG SELL43,5532,094,295+2,050,742Transaction Details
20172141 x48 x4,468808,128 STRONG SELL43,56317,662,592+17,619,029Transaction Details
20171373 x120 x12,0495,120,304 STRONG SELL43,55359,120,107+59,076,554Transaction Details
201612434 x71 x4,878464,750 STRONG SELL43,56310,399,552+10,355,989Transaction Details
201611464 x33 x104,7942,043,727 STRONG SELL47,81010,696,646+10,648,836Transaction Details
201610699 x25 x280,5566,300,075 STRONG SELL87,1262,266,496+2,179,370Transaction Details
20169535 x3 x16,85817,828 SELL43,563420,737+377,174Transaction Details
20168444 x31 x5,243285,946 STRONG SELL06,307,851+6,307,851Transaction Details
20167080 x17 x0120,913 STRONG SELL02,383,390+2,383,390Transaction Details
20166325 x10 x4,526109,475 STRONG SELL83,2421,882,803+1,799,561Transaction Details
20165384 x25 x120,2102,424,576 STRONG SELL02,741,126+2,741,126Transaction Details
20164141 x16 x6,900160,290 STRONG SELL85,4912,700,251+2,614,760Transaction Details
20163333 x9 x70526,184 STRONG SELL0966,026+966,026Transaction Details
20162040 x5 x080,542 STRONG SELL01,007,826+1,007,826Transaction Details
20161151 x9 x2,300156,796 STRONG SELL28,4971,905,796+1,877,299Transaction Details
201512447 x4 x3,1197,166 STRONG SELL28,497135,432+106,935Transaction Details
201511161 x9 x2,30048,470 STRONG SELL28,497950,061+921,564Transaction Details
201510121 x2 x2,3009,258 STRONG SELL28,497176,872+148,375Transaction Details
20159343 x8 x11,88351,198 STRONG SELL149,2551,412,211+1,262,956Transaction Details
20158353 x8 x11,88350,514 STRONG SELL149,2551,361,361+1,212,106Transaction Details
20157777 x17 x23,669105,059 STRONG SELL248,3064,103,246+3,854,940Transaction Details
20156777 x33 x19,644272,694 STRONG SELL248,28611,226,067+10,977,781Transaction Details
2015541512 x85 x78,9068,102,423 STRONG SELL500,61617,614,352+17,113,736Transaction Details
20154779 x117 x264,875353,031 SELL213,13114,213,440+14,000,308Transaction Details
20153575 x148 x16,931418,466 STRONG SELL213,13116,195,374+15,982,243Transaction Details
201523103 x117 x17,2435,602,403 STRONG SELL213,131120,684,584+120,471,452Transaction Details
201512122 x109 x16,875931,852 STRONG SELL213,13133,702,482+33,489,351Transaction Details
201412575 x153 x16,935409,373 STRONG SELL213,13114,276,077+14,062,945Transaction Details
2014112102 x141 x16,8751,087,286 STRONG SELL213,13134,341,959+34,128,828Transaction Details
20141051110 x160 x139,3763,026,660 STRONG SELL449,50684,002,635+83,553,128Transaction Details
20149647 x37 x15,29481,712 STRONG SELL218,5232,291,457+2,072,934Transaction Details
20148637 x16 x119,40248,664 STRONG BUY213,7411,352,786+1,139,045Transaction Details
201475138 x148 x48,5382,343,441 STRONG SELL249,63815,977,335+15,727,698Transaction Details
20146264 x97 x20,625121,723 STRONG SELL249,6383,595,186+3,345,548Transaction Details
20145151 x29 x5,62589,397 STRONG SELL59,7382,524,112+2,464,375Transaction Details
20144111 x1 x25,0004,237 SELL0114,696+114,696Transaction Details
20143010 x1 x03,076 STRONG SELL0111,074+111,074Transaction Details
20142020 x2 x028,492 STRONG SELL0888,197+888,197Transaction Details
20141111 x1 x5,0003,239 SELL0115,891+115,891Transaction Details